# Zephyr Modules

Extend the Zephyr RTOS with reusable, out-of-tree modules that integrate seamlessly with the build system.

## Core Workflows

### 1. Defining a Module
Create the directory structure and metadata required for auto-discovery.
- **Reference**: **[module_definition.md](references/module_definition.md)**
- **Key Tools**: `zephyr/module.yml`, `zephyr/Kconfig`, `zephyr/CMakeLists.txt`.

### 2. West Manifest Integration
Adding your module to a workspace for distribution and versioning.
- **Reference**: **[west_integration.md](references/west_integration.md)**
- **Key Tools**: `west.yml`, `west update`, `west build -t list_modules`.

### 3. Library Wrapping (Glue Code)
Wrapping external C/C++ libraries as Zephyr modules.
- **Reference**: **[module_definition.md](references/module_definition.md#the-glue-pattern)**
- **Key Tools**: `zephyr_library()`, `zephyr_include_directories()`.

## Quick Start (module.yml)
```yaml
build:
  cmake: .
  kconfig: zephyr/Kconfig
```

## Validation Checklist
- [ ] `west update` fetches module source from manifest without conflicts.
- [ ] `west build -t list_modules` shows the module as discovered.
- [ ] Module Kconfig options appear and can be enabled in build configuration.
- [ ] Module sources are compiled and linked into the target application as expected.
